Is computer science and technology a good course?

In today’s digital era, the world is constantly evolving, and technology plays a pivotal role in shaping the way we live, work, and interact. Consequently, computer science and technology have emerged as an increasingly popular field of study for students seeking a rewarding career and a chance to contribute to the fast-paced advancements of the digital age. In this article, we will explore the merits of pursuing a course in computer science and technology and delve into the various opportunities and challenges associated with it.

Understanding Computer Science and Technology

2.1 What is Computer Science?

Computer science is the scientific study of computers and their applications. It encompasses various areas, such as programming, algorithms, data structures, artificial intelligence, and software development. Computer scientists design, analyze, and develop computer systems to solve complex problems efficiently.

2.2 The Importance of Technology

Technology has become an integral part of modern society, touching almost every aspect of our lives. From smartphones and social media to advanced medical equipment and space exploration, technology drives progress and innovation across industries.

2.3 The Relationship between Computer Science and Technology

Computer science and technology are interconnected. Computer science provides the theoretical foundation and practical tools necessary to create innovative technologies that enhance our lives. Technological advancements, in turn, fuel further exploration and breakthroughs in the field of computer science.

The Growing Relevance of Computer Science and Technology

3.1 Demand in the Job Market

The digital revolution has led to an ever-increasing demand for skilled professionals in computer science and technology. Graduates with expertise in this field are highly sought after by industries ranging from finance and healthcare to entertainment and cybersecurity.

3.2 Role in Advancements

Computer science and technology are instrumental in driving progress. They have transformed industries, allowing for automation, data analysis, and efficient communication, thus revolutionizing the way businesses operate and people interact.

3.3 Impact on Various Industries

The application of computer science and technology has had a profound impact on diverse sectors. For example, in healthcare, technology has enabled advancements in medical treatments and telemedicine, improving patient care and outcomes.

Benefits of Studying Computer Science and Technology

4.1 Lucrative Career Opportunities

One of the significant advantages of pursuing a course in computer science and technology is the abundance of lucrative career opportunities. Graduates can explore roles as software developers, data scientists, cybersecurity experts, and much more.

4.2 Problem-Solving Skills

Computer science and technology courses instill exceptional problem-solving skills in students. They learn how to approach challenges from analytical and creative perspectives, finding innovative solutions to real-world issues.

4.3 Versatility and Interdisciplinary Nature

Computer science and technology are highly versatile fields that complement other disciplines. Graduates can seamlessly integrate their knowledge into various industries, making them valuable assets in today’s job market.

Challenges and Misconceptions

5.1 Rigorous Curriculum

Computer science and technology courses can be rigorous and demanding. Students may encounter complex mathematical concepts and coding challenges, requiring dedication and perseverance to excel.

5.2 Gender Representation

Despite the growing interest in computer science, there remains a gender gap in the field. Encouraging more women to pursue technology-related courses is essential for a diverse and inclusive future.

5.3 Perceived Difficulty

Some students may be hesitant to pursue computer science and technology due to a perceived difficulty in grasping technical concepts. However, with the right guidance and support, anyone can thrive in this field.

Tips for Excelling in Computer Science and Technology Courses

6.1 Embrace the Basics

Building a strong foundation is crucial. Embrace the fundamental principles of computer science to gain a solid understanding of the subject.

6.2 Engage in Hands-on Projects

Practical experience is invaluable. Engage in hands-on projects to apply theoretical knowledge and enhance your problem-solving abilities.

6.3 Seek Collaboration and Networking

Collaborate with peers and professionals to exchange ideas and insights. Networking can open doors to internships, job opportunities, and mentorship.

The Future of Computer Science and Technology

7.1 Technological Advancements

As technology evolves, the possibilities are limitless. Artificial intelligence, quantum computing, and blockchain are just a few areas that hold immense promise for the future.

7.2 Ethical Considerations

Advancements in computer science and technology also raise ethical questions. Striking a balance between progress and responsible innovation is crucial for a sustainable future.

7.3 Impact on Society

The future of computer science and technology will significantly impact society at large. From reshaping industries to influencing how we live and interact, its effects will be profound.


In conclusion, pursuing a course in computer science and technology offers numerous opportunities for personal and professional growth. The field’s ever-increasing relevance, coupled with the chance to drive technological advancements, makes it an exciting choice for aspiring students. Embracing the challenges and misconceptions, students can excel by focusing on foundational knowledge, practical experience, and collaboration. As technology continues to evolve, computer science and technology will play an integral role in shaping the world’s future.

